    Most German players aren’t going to try to make the link on Germany’s second turn, rather waiting until Germany’s third turn when they can have a chance to have their two fleets even remotely positioned right.

    Thus, most Russian players will put the Submarine in SZ 2 with the British Battleship and Transport.  This stops Germany from attacking with 2 fighters, bomber and submarine to sink the second British Battleship. (Fighters can land in Norway.)

    Well, let me ask you what you want to do with your sub.  Either you want to increase its options for the next turn and possibly distract the Germans (move it west but don’t join the UK fleet), or help the UK fleet survive and increase its options for next turn (join the UK fleet).

    Since you can’t count on the Germans losing their heads and sending a fighter after the Russian sub, and since helping a 24 IPC UK battleship survive is arguably a good investment for a 8 IPC sub that isn’t going to do much other than block a German invasion of London, it is LOGICAL for the Russian sub to join the UK fleet.

    BTW, that submarine does not become useless once the Germans lose the ability to win against the Allied navy/navies.

    I like to send it to Southern Africa to ‘persuade’ Japan not to make a Brazil run, at least, force Japan to commit more to a Brazil run then what is normal and optimal.  It also keeps Japan honest by not leaving transports out there undefended.

    And, finally, I’ve had a situation where Japan FORGOT the Russian submarine was down there by Madagascar and been able to attack his battleship and 3 transports with 3 fighters and a submarine. Odds are, he only gets one hit, you get 2, that’s a good trade!  Japanese transport which is useful for Russian submarine which is not so useful. (I actually got 3 hits to his 1 that time, but I was lucky.)
